The Rise of Cashless Transactions

The global shift toward cashless economies has accelerated significantly over the last decade. Consumers now expect convenience, speed, and security when making purchases online or in physical stores. Mobile wallets, QR-code payments, contactless cards, and online banking have become common methods for completing transactions within seconds.

This transformation is driven by technological advancements and changing customer behavior. People no longer want to carry large amounts of cash or spend time waiting for manual payment processing. Instead, they prefer streamlined payment methods that integrate directly with smartphones, tablets, and e-commerce platforms.

Businesses that adapt to these changing expectations gain a major advantage. They can provide smoother customer experiences, reduce operational delays, and build stronger trust with clients through secure transaction systems.

 

Benefits of Advanced Payment Technologies

Modern payment systems offer several advantages that go beyond simple money transfers. One of the primary benefits is enhanced transaction speed. Automated systems eliminate unnecessary delays and reduce human errors, allowing businesses to process payments efficiently.

Security is another major advantage. Advanced encryption technologies and fraud detection systems help protect sensitive customer information from cyber threats. Businesses that implement secure payment systems can build long-term credibility and customer loyalty.

Additionally, digital payment platforms provide better financial transparency. Real-time transaction tracking enables organizations to monitor revenue, analyze spending patterns, and make informed business decisions. This level of insight can improve budgeting strategies and operational planning.

Another significant benefit is global accessibility. Businesses can now accept payments from customers across different countries without dealing with complicated traditional banking limitations. This opens the door to international expansion and broader customer reach.

 

How Payment Innovation Improves Customer Experience

Customer experience has become one of the most important aspects of business success. Fast and reliable payment methods contribute directly to customer satisfaction. When people encounter lengthy checkout procedures or failed payment attempts, they are more likely to abandon purchases and move toward competitors.

Modern payment technologies solve this challenge by offering frictionless transactions. Features such as one-click payments, biometric authentication, and automated billing create a smooth and efficient purchasing process.

Subscription-based services, online retailers, and service providers especially benefit from recurring payment systems that reduce manual effort for customers. Automated reminders and digital invoices further enhance convenience while improving payment collection efficiency for businesses.

The integ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ning is also revolutionizing customer interactions. Smart systems can detect suspicious activities, personalize payment experiences, and optimize transaction approval rates.

Security and Compliance in Digital Transactions

As digital transactions increase, cybersecurity becomes a top priority for organizations. Payment providers must ensure compliance with financial regulations and maintain high security standards to protect customer data.

Secure authentication processes, tokenization, and end-to-end encryption help prevent unauthorized access and fraud. Businesses that prioritize security demonstrate reliability and professionalism, which are critical for customer trust.

Regulatory compliance is equally important. Financial authorities across different regions enforce strict standards regarding transaction monitoring, anti-money laundering measures, and customer data privacy. Organizations that fail to comply with these regulations risk financial penalties and reputational damage.

Investing in secure payment infrastructure is therefore not just a technical necessity but also a strategic business decision.

Future Trends in Payment Technology

The future of payment systems is expected to become even more innovative and interconnected. Technologies such as blockchain, artificial intelligence, and biometric verification are likely to redefine transaction processes in the coming years.

Cryptocurrency-based payments are gradually gaining attention among businesses and consumers seeking decentralized financial solutions. Meanwhile, voice-activated payments and wearable payment devices are introducing new levels of convenience.

Another emerging trend is the integration of payment systems into social media platforms and digital ecosystems. Customers increasingly prefer purchasing products directly through apps they already use daily, creating opportunities for businesses to simplify the buying journey.

Companies that stay updated with technological trends will be better positioned to adapt to changing consumer expectations and industry demands.
